  • Publication number: 20170263836
    Abstract: A method of producing a device includes providing a strip-shaped leadframe, wherein the leadframe includes leadframe sections arranged in a row next to one another and connection structures connecting the leadframe sections, the connection structures each connecting two adjacent leadframe sections; forming molded bodies on the leadframe, the molded bodies each mechanically connecting two adjacent leadframe sections; arranging semiconductor chips on the leadframe; and interrupting the connections of the leadframe sections realized by the connection structures.

  • Publication number: 20170200875
    Abstract: An optoelectronic component includes a carrier strip and an optoelectronic semiconductor chip, a first electrical connection surface formed on a front side of the chip and a second electrical connection surface is formed on a rear side of the chip, first and second electrically conductive contact regions are formed on the strip, the first region is arranged on a folding section of the strip, the rear side of the chip faces toward an upper side of the strip, the upper side faces toward the front side of the chip, the first electrical connection surface electrically conductively connects to the first region, the second electrical connection surface electrically conductively connects to the second region by a second connecting material, the strip has a second through-opening that lies next to the second region, and the second connecting material extends through the second contact opening to a lower side of the strip.

  • Patent number: 9341361
    Abstract: A light emitter with a radiation exit surface including a housing part with a receptacle, at least one organic optoelectronic device, arranged in the receptacle, and at least one cover part joined to the housing part, wherein the device is mounted between the cover part and the housing part.

  • Publication number: 20070210703
    Abstract: An electroluminescent device 1 comprising a functional region 5, which emits light having a first spectral distribution 7, and comprising a filter layer 10, which is arranged in the beam path 6 of the functional region 5 and absorbs spectral subranges of the light of the first spectral distribution, with the result that light having a second spectral distribution is emitted by the device 1.

  • Patent number: 7026660
    Abstract: A device having bond pads within a bond pad region, the bond pads comprising a conductive material that is stable when exposed to atmospheric constituents. The bond pads can be formed from conductive oxide materials such as indium tin oxide. A contact layer is provided to enhance the conductivity between the bond pads and the active component of the device.
